June 13, 2011
With under three months to go until the start of the inaugural Winston-Salem Open, a first-class tennis facility is rising out of the ground next to BB&T Field.
All of the tournament courts have been laid out, and workers are almost finished with the process of putting down asphalt on top of them. Work is still being done on constructing the six courts that will be used for varsity competition by the Wake Forest men's and women's tennis teams and will also serve as practice courts for the ATP tournament.
The construction is on schedule for a July finish.

The two long banks will each contain three courts, with two of them on each being used for the Winston-Salem Open. The court to the left of the picture that is being covered in asphalt will be the stadium court

Holes have been left in the asphalt for the net posts and center strap.

Workers are in the process of laying down asphalt on the stadium court.


North of the stadium, a bulldozer grades the land where the six Wake Forest varsity courts will be located.

In this view from above, you can clearly see two banks of courts layed out. There will be three courts in each of these banks, with two on each bank being used for the Winston-Salem open

This bank of courts will house two of the larger show courts for the Winston-Salem Open. The dirt area in the foreground is where the stadium court will be constructed.

Workers install the wooden frame that will surround the courts.

Gravel is beginning to be laid down on top of the graded dirt. It will form the bottom layer of the courts with asphalt and then the court surface being placed on top of it.

This bank will feature three courts, with two of them hosting matches during the early round of the tournament.

The lights for the new tennis facility sit in the Gold Lot next to Bridger Field House waiting to be installed.

A bird's-eye view of the construction site from the top of the East Stands of BB&T Field. The facility is being built on what used to be the Green Lot, between the Indoor Tennis Center and BB&T Field

A look in at the construction from the parking lot of the Indoor Tennis Center. When the new facility is completed, the Wake Forest tennis teams' indoor and outdoor courts will be located right next to each other.
